代码生成
最后修改时间:2022 年 7 月 19 日文件 | 设置 | 编辑| 代码风格| SQL | <SQL 方言> | Windows 和 Linux 的代码生成
PyCharm | 设置 | 编辑| 代码风格| SQL | <SQL 方言> | macOS 的代码生成
CtrlAlt0S
配置索引、主键和外键的代码生成行为。
该选项卡包含主键和外键约束以及索引的名称模板。当您在“创建表”或“修改表”对话框中创建约束和索引时,这些模板用于生成约束和索引的默认名称。
模板可以包含变量和文本。当您生成名称时,指定的文本将按字面意思再现。例如,当您{table}_pk
在actor
表中应用模板时,生成的主键名称将为actor_pk
。
要查看有关变量及其用法的信息,请单击字段并按。Ctrl0Q
{unique?u:}
检查索引是否唯一并插入相应的字符序列。?
如果索引是唯一的,模板将生成一个名称,该名称具有和之间指定的字符序列:
。对于{unique?u:}
模板来说,它是u
. 如果索引不唯一,则插入:
和之间的序列。}
对于{unique?u:}
模板来说,这不算什么。
例子
您有persons
包含列FirstName
和的表LastName
。该{table}_{columns}_{unique?u:}index
模板为非唯一索引生成以下名称:persons_FirstName_LastName_index
。
设置从...
单击此链接可显示用作当前语言代码样式基础的语言列表。仅采用适用于当前语言的设置。所有其他设置不受影响。
如果适用,此链接将显示在特定于语言的代码样式页面的右上角。
单击“重置”放弃更改并返回到初始的代码样式设置集。
感谢您的反馈意见!
此页面是否有帮助?